Jailer killed in role-playing shooting, authorities say

By
ATLANTA - A Fulton County jailer who was acting out scenarios he learned in training accidentally shot and killed another jailer. <br> <br> Authorities say the shooting happened Sunday night in southwest Atlanta. <br> <br> A single gunshot killed 23-year-old Mychiska Patterson, a jailer who had worked for the Fulton County sheriff&#39;s department for two years. <br> <br> Twenty-eight-year-old Dean Ricketts was charged with involuntary manslaughter. <br> <br> Fulton County sheriff&#39;s Major Clarence Huber said Ricketts was training to become a full-fledged deputy. <br> <br> But as a jailer, he was not authorized to carry a firearm and the gun was not sheriff&#39;s department property. <br> <br> Atlanta police say the gun&#39;s magazine had been removed during the role-playing, but the round in the chamber had not been removed.
